萌娘百科讨论:讨论版/技术实现/存档/2022年11月
讨论版【技术实现】档案馆
mzh验证问题
如题,搜索内容需要验证,验证后页面加载也不完整,刷新之后又要验证如此循环往复;有时浏览条目也要验证,并且验证似乎并没有一个固定的有效期,看条目的时候可能开两三个页面就要验证一次,登录账号无法缓解。(注:不要向我强推APP)--忒有钱(讨论) 2022年10月8日 (六) 12:31 (CST)
- Help:WAF—— 兽耳控⭐一位史蒂夫 (讨论·贡献)✉❶ 快来单推可爱的雏羽吧~ 2022年10月9日 (日) 01:22 (CST)
- 拼图是吧,不是WAF。但也是防范措施,忍一忍吧……? あめろ 讨论 2022年10月9日 (日) 02:02 (CST)
- 请检查自己的网络环境,mzh的图形验证码目前仅针对自动程序识别,正常使用时不应该频繁触发该验证。机智的小鱼君⚡ (留言✨) 2022年10月9日 (日) 16:37 (CST)
- 有必要时做点验证没有什么问题,不过不应该频繁到阻碍正常浏览或编辑的程度。—— Eric Liu 創造は生命(留言·留名) 2022年10月11日 (二) 09:26 (CST)
- (~)补充 (虽然其实对你百的访问问题已经“习惯了.jpg”,不过)有时候mzh页面上的注释也会被block住,表现为点击[1]显示“无法加载blabla”,references栏显示成一个链接,点进去刷两遍验证码后进入一个Special页(懒得找是哪个了x)。
- 另外,确实多刷几遍验证码总比WAF十分钟强()——C8H17OH(讨论) 2022年10月11日 (二) 16:12 (CST)
关于{{Toggle}}模板的问题
在查阅关于纳西妲#故事的修改记录时,编辑者Ypaafw[更多]在历史记录6459916版中使用了{{TextHover}}容纳魔神任务前后的文本变化,结果发现直接使用TextHover在手机端页面切换文本显示不现实,因此想要用{{Toggle}}模板保留手动切换入口。
但是在使用{{Toggle}}模板的HTML直接写法发现,有时会遇到浏览器未及时加载JS脚本导致模板效果失效的问题,直接显示变化前后的内容,这种界面事故往往伴随着“不会见到WikiPlus快速编辑按钮”的现象一起发生。
基于{{Toggle}}是HTML+JavaScript写法,而且我在使用的时候可以不用模板直接用HTML语法直接嵌套JS模板,询问一下能不能像{{TextHover}}一样复刻出使用HTML+Lua语法的模板。
源码 | 实现效果 | ||||
---|---|---|---|---|---|
纳西妲#故事在Ypaafw[更多]修改后的6459916版节选 | |||||
<small>''完成魔神任务 第三章 第五幕 「虚空鼓动,劫火高扬」后,「角色详细」、「角色故事1」、「角色故事3」、「角色故事4」、「纳西妲的『玩具箱』」中的文本将替换为如下文本(鼠标悬停可查看原文本)''</small>
{| class="wikitable"
|-
! 角色详细
|-
|{{TextHover|<poem>
许久之前,草神创造了须弥雨林,又通过教令院将智慧赐予国民。
她的美名无处不在,千万个故事,只为传唱她的事迹与美德而问世。
在人民眼中,草神的存在更像是一种符号化的象征——因此,他们才能确信神明的庇护自古就存在于这片土地之上。
城中至贤对草神崇拜备至,民众也坚定不移地追随其后。
而影响诸多的「虚空」系统,则是「小吉祥草王」的耳与目。
它给予她遍历人们喜怒哀乐的能力,令她听见看见一切,让她理解了赞美之外的声音。
见闻越是拓展,她越明白自己必须不断学习。
她唯有尽快成长,才能面对来自世界最深处的威胁。
无法逃离,那是她无法回避的使命。
即便没多少人对现状不满,纳西妲依旧坚定不移。
她的顽强来源于信念,她比任何人都明白——在这里,她将是所有人的寄托与依靠。
</poem>|<poem>
「大慈树王」创造了须弥雨林,又通过教令院将智慧赐予国民。即便她与世长辞,其美名也仍在家喻户晓的故事中传唱。
而在神陨之后被贤者们迎回净善宫的「小吉祥草王」,更像是一种符号化的象征——以此昭示神明的庇佑并未从这片土地上消失。
可她究竟是谁,如何降生,又具备怎样的权能,知晓答案之人少之又少。
城中至贤对「小吉祥草王」闪烁其词,民众逐渐从回避的态度中读出了答案,不再奢望神明的智慧凭空降下。
「虚空」一如既往高效又便捷,那也是「大慈树王」遗留的神迹,可人们不知道的是,如今「虚空」也成为了新诞神明的耳与目。
她利用「虚空」遍历了人们的喜怒哀乐,当然也知晓他们对旧神的崇拜与新神的失望,与诸如「智慧之神已经不复存在」的评价。
她深知自己必须不断学习,尽快成长,才能面对来自世界最深处的威胁,这是她无法回避的使命。
不被理解也好,不被重视也好,纳西妲对此并无意见。
</poem>}}
|} | 完成魔神任务 第三章 第五幕 「虚空鼓动,劫火高扬」后,「角色详细」、「角色故事1」、「角色故事3」、「角色故事4」、「纳西妲的『玩具箱』」中的文本将替换为如下文本(鼠标悬停可查看原文本)
| ||||
U:李皇谛/Sandbox历史版本6460235 节选 | |||||
一些故事文本会在玩家完成魔神任务第三章第五幕 「虚空鼓动,劫火高扬」后遭到替换,被替换的角色文本将在右侧显示一个“切换按钮”。<br>
<small>您正在查看的是<span class="mw-collapsible show" id="mw-customcollapsible-纳西妲角色故事" style="display:inline-block; color:green;">任务完成后</span><span class="mw-collapsible mw-collapsed" id="mw-customcollapsible-纳西妲角色故事" style="color:blue; display:inline-block;">任务完成前</span>的故事文本。</small>
{| class="wikitable"
|-
!角色详细||<div class="mw-customtoggle-纳西妲角色故事" style="cursor:pointer; font-family:Segoe UI Symbol,宋体, monospace;">🔄️</div>
|-
|colspan=2|<poem class="mw-collapsible show" id="mw-customcollapsible-纳西妲角色故事">
许久之前,草神创造了须弥雨林,又通过教令院将智慧赐予国民。
她的美名无处不在,千万个故事,只为传唱她的事迹与美德而问世。
在人民眼中,草神的存在更像是一种符号化的象征——因此,他们才能确信神明的庇护自古就存在于这片土地之上。
城中至贤对草神崇拜备至,民众也坚定不移地追随其后。
而影响诸多的「虚空」系统,则是「小吉祥草王」的耳与目。
它给予她遍历人们喜怒哀乐的能力,令她听见看见一切,让她理解了赞美之外的声音。
见闻越是拓展,她越明白自己必须不断学习。
她唯有尽快成长,才能面对来自世界最深处的威胁。
无法逃离,那是她无法回避的使命。
即便没多少人对现状不满,纳西妲依旧坚定不移。
她的顽强来源于信念,她比任何人都明白——在这里,她将是所有人的寄托与依靠。
</poem><poem class="mw-collapsible mw-collapsed" id="mw-customcollapsible-纳西妲角色故事">
「大慈树王」创造了须弥雨林,又通过教令院将智慧赐予国民。即便她与世长辞,其美名也仍在家喻户晓的故事中传唱。
而在神陨之后被贤者们迎回净善宫的「小吉祥草王」,更像是一种符号化的象征——以此昭示神明的庇佑并未从这片土地上消失。
可她究竟是谁,如何降生,又具备怎样的权能,知晓答案之人少之又少。
城中至贤对「小吉祥草王」闪烁其词,民众逐渐从回避的态度中读出了答案,不再奢望神明的智慧凭空降下。
「虚空」一如既往高效又便捷,那也是「大慈树王」遗留的神迹,可人们不知道的是,如今「虚空」也成为了新诞神明的耳与目。
她利用「虚空」遍历了人们的喜怒哀乐,当然也知晓他们对旧神的崇拜与新神的失望,与诸如「智慧之神已经不复存在」的评价。
她深知自己必须不断学习,尽快成长,才能面对来自世界最深处的威胁,这是她无法回避的使命。
不被理解也好,不被重视也好,纳西妲对此并无意见。
</poem>
|} | 一些故事文本会在玩家完成魔神任务第三章第五幕 「虚空鼓动,劫火高扬」后遭到替换,被替换的角色文本将在右侧显示一个“切换按钮”。 您正在查看的是任务完成后任务完成前的故事文本。
|
✏️李皇谛(💬留言/📝记录)🕓 2022年11月18日 (五) 15:08 (CST)
- 可以用{{切换显示按钮}}的内联JS配合模板样式表。我在沙盒里做了个示例。——移动版用户 Bhsd 2022年11月19日 (六) 02:35 (CST)
- 非常感谢,已经花了两个小时的时间校对文本然后复制CSS配置表,现在更改已经提交到6462184版了。✏️李皇谛(💬留言/📝记录)🕓 2022年11月19日 (六) 16:09 (CST)